The Legacy of Tiny7: A Deep Dive into the Ultra-Lightweight Windows 7 Tiny7 is a legendary, stripped-down modification of Windows 7 Ultimate (32-bit/x86) created by the developer eXPerience

3. Malware Risks

Since Tiny7 is not an official Microsoft product, you are downloading it from third-party websites, forums, or torrent trackers. There is a high risk that the ISO has been injected with malware, keyloggers, or trojans. Always scan any downloaded ISO with a virus scanner before use.

While Tiny7 is an impressive feat of optimization, it comes with significant trade-offs that users should weigh carefully before installation.
